English Reading Comprehension Grade 3The following are some key points about reading comprehension:
** 1. Common Questions and Solution Skills **
1. ** Factual details **
- This type of question mainly tested the understanding of the specific information in the article. Usually, the problem could be solved in the following ways:
- First, read the question, clarify the content of the question, and determine the key words. For example, in the reading comprehension of the MacBike, the key words were " MacBike " and " advantage " for questions like " What are the advantages of the MacBike?"
- Then, he quickly located the relevant paragraph or sentence in the article with the keywords. For example, in the MacBike article, the answer could be found by locating the "Why MacBike" section according to the keywords.
- Carefully compare the options with the original information, pay attention to whether the expressions in the options are exactly the same as the original text, and avoid being misled by similar expressions.
2. ** Reasoning and Judgment Questions **
- He needed to make logical deductions based on the information in the article.
- He had to grasp the overall content and theme of the article, because the reasoning was based on the overall context of the article. For example, in the article about " The drought affects meat production in North America," if one wanted to infer the overall impact of the drought on agriculture, one would need to combine the difficulties of raising cattle and the growth of other crops in the article.
- Pay attention to suggestive words or sentences in the text, such as "may","might","suggest","imply", etc. These words often indicate the direction of reasoning.
3. ** Main idea **
- Examining the understanding of the main idea of the article.
- You can grasp the general content of the article by reading the beginning, the end, and the first sentence of each paragraph. For example, in some articles that introduced new things or phenomena, the beginning might introduce the main topic and the end would summarize the views.
- Eliminate the options that are too one-sided or inconsistent with the content of the article. If the article was about a variety of factors affecting agriculture, the choice only mentioned one factor and could not be the main idea.

** 3. Ways to improve Senior Three English reading comprehension ability **
1. ** Accumulated vocabulary **
- Enlarging one's vocabulary was the key. It could be done by memorizing vocabulary books, reading English articles, and sorting out new words.
- Pay attention to the polysemy, synonym, antonemy, etc. of words. For example, although "economic" and "economic" are both related to the economy, their meanings are different.
2. ** Reading Training **
- Every day, he would insist on reading a certain amount of English articles, which could be the real college entrance examination questions, English newspapers, magazines, etc.
- In the process of reading, improve reading speed and comprehension ability, learn to guess the meaning of words according to the context, analyze the sentence structure, etc.
3. ** Analyzing Wrong Questions **
- Carefully analyze the wrong questions and find out the reason for your mistakes. Is it because of vocabulary problems, understanding errors, or lack of solving skills?
- Make targeted improvements based on the reasons for the mistakes, such as strengthening vocabulary memory, adjusting the solution to the problem, etc.

Grade 1 Reading English Story: How to Start?For grade 1 reading English story, start by choosing a story with big and clear fonts. This makes it easier to read. Next, use your finger to follow the words as you read. This helps you keep your place and also focuses your attention. You can start with very short stories, like those with just a few sentences. Read them aloud so you can hear how the words sound. This will also help you with your pronunciation.
